Output 32d6aadab8efaf223654c871959d49c45667f10fbda65744ea990bd9363ce0d6:10

value
886341796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8097f75ecc2139e4ac719b1f779bc6b1e79ca110 OP_EQUAL
address
3DQxTuDDwCdFJ2mhVXUphPDmMBENWTzxu7
transaction
32d6aadab8efaf223654c871959d49c45667f10fbda65744ea990bd9363ce0d6
spent
true